Once again Lawrence is joined by some fascinating guests in this episode of SBS Radio.

Mike Zourdos is an assistant professor at Florida Atlantic University and is the director of the muscle physiology lab there. What he doesn't know about muscles isn't worth knowing and Eric Helms is a PhD Candidate studying Strength and Conditioning so he knows S&C inside out. Eric is also a body building coach with a focus on Science based coaching.

The three guys gather around the microphone to talk about the six levels of the training pyramid. What's that you say? We're not going to tell you here, you best download this episode and subscribe!
